About the Role
This is a part-time, short-term contract opportunity supporting high-profile project pursuits. The role can be worked remotely or on a hybrid basis in the Greater Boston area (preferred) and requires approximately 20-30 hours per week during standard business hours.
Responsibilities
- Partner with project teams, operations leaders, and technical subject matter experts to gather information for business development and pursuit efforts.
- Develop and refine technical narratives, project approaches, case studies, best practices, logistics plans, and other proposal content.
- Translate complex construction and project delivery concepts into clear, persuasive, and audience-focused written materials.
- Ensure proposal content is accurate, well-organized, compliant with pursuit requirements, and aligned with strategic objectives.
- Collaborate with proposal and marketing teams to support multiple concurrent pursuits while meeting tight deadlines and turnaround times.
Qualifications
- 5+ years of proposal writing, technical writing, or pursuit development experience within construction, architecture, engineering, or related AEC environments.
- Prior experience supporting a construction management firm, general contractor, architecture firm, engineering company, or similar organization preferred.
- Strong understanding of construction terminology, project execution strategies, operational processes, sequencing, logistics planning, and technical project delivery concepts.
- Proven ability to interview subject matter experts and transform technical information into compelling proposal content.
- Experience developing technical narratives, project descriptions, qualifications packages, case studies, and pursuit-related materials.
- Excellent written communication, editing, proofreading, and document organization skills.
- Advanced Microsoft Word proficiency required.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ities, work independently, and operate effectively in a deadline-driven environment.
- Writing samples or portfolio of proposal-related work required.
